member of our team. Job Description We are seeking a skilled and
compassionate CT Radiographer to join our team in Towson, United
States. As a key member of our diagnostic imaging department, you
will play a crucial role in providing high-quality CT scans to aid
in patient diagnosis and treatment planning. Operate CT scanning
equipment to produce high-quality diagnostic images Ensure patient
safety by adhering to radiation protection guidelines and ALARA
principles Position patients accurately for optimal image
acquisition Explain procedures to patients and address their
concerns to ensure comfort during scans Collaborate with
radiologists and other healthcare professionals to optimize imaging
protocols Maintain and troubleshoot CT equipment, reporting any
issues promptly Accurately document patient information and scan
details in the hospital information system Participate in quality
assurance activities to maintain imaging standards Stay current
with advancements in CT technology and imaging techniques
Qualifications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Radiologic
Technology ARRT certification in Computed Tomography Current state
radiologic technologist license Proficiency in operating CT
scanning equipment and related software Strong knowledge of
radiation safety protocols and ALARA principles Excellent patient
positioning skills and attention to detail Ability to assess image
quality and make necessary adjustments Experience with PACS
(Picture Archiving and Communication System) In-depth understanding
of human anatomy and pathology Knowledge of various CT protocols
for different diagnostic procedures Strong communication skills and
ability to work effectively in a team environment Commitment to
ongoing professional development and staying updated with industry
advancements Additional Information All your information will be
